Originally Posted by Shadow_Wave View Post
If you figure out how to make project reality to work for Vista can you tell me PLZ.
Because my comp will run the game it well pop up the battlefield sign then it well go light black then dark black then again again about 4 times then quit back to the desktop
Right click on icon, make sure "run as administrator" and "run in windows xp compatibility mode" are selected. Then update/reinstall PB.
